Job Description

Job Overview We are seeking a detail-oriented and motivated Fiber Optic Planner to support the rollout of fiber infrastructure. This role involves creating, updating and maintaining fiber optic network plans, ensuring accurate mapping and data integrity. Applicants must be familiar with tools such as AutoCAD Civil 3D and ArcGIS. Minimum Requirements: 13 years of experience in fibre optic network planning. Proficient in ArcGIS (essential) and AutoCAD (preferred), with the ability to complete as-built drawings on ArcGIS as a primary responsibility. Strong attention to detail and data accuracy, with the ability to read and interpret network designs, redlines, duct allocations and splicing diagrams. Ability to excel under pressure and manage competing priorities while supporting multiple teams. Diploma or certification in a technical or telecoms-related field is advantageous. Strong command of spoken English. Ability to work effectively with internal and external field teams. Must be able to work US hours (see below) . This is a fully office-based role; a hybrid working model will not be considered. Key Responsibilities Prepare and maintain fiber optic network layouts and designs. Assist with high-level and low-level design planning. Use AutoCAD Civil 3D and ArcGIS for design and mapping tasks. Ensure all planning documentation is accurate and up to date. Work closely with field and engineering teams to update designs. Support data integrity and compliance with design standards. Report planning progress and raise design concerns proactively. Work Schedule & Compensation Notes This is a full-time, non-exempt position based on a 40-hour work week. Primarily based in the office around Melrose Johannesburg. Working hours: 2:00 PM to 11:00 PM (Monday to Friday) From the 2nd Sunday of March until the 1st Sunday of November 3:00 PM to 12:00 AM (Monday to Friday) From the 1st Sunday in November until the 2nd Sunday of March US public holidays will apply. South African public holidays will not apply 15 days of leave

About IT / Computing / Software Jobs in Gauteng

In Gauteng, the IT and computing industry is a significant contributor to the province’s economy, with a steady demand for skilled professionals. Typically, this field is characterized by rapid technological advancements, innovative projects, and a high level of job satisfaction among employees. Generally, career prospects in this sector are strong, with a range of opportunities available across various industries.

Salaries for IT and computing professionals in Gauteng can vary widely dep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. While it is common to see salaries ranging from R400 000 to R1,200 000 per annum, these figures are only a general guideline and actual salaries may differ significantly. For instance, senior executives or technical leads with extensive experience may command higher salaries, while entry-level positions may start at lower levels.

Common skills required for IT and computing roles in Gauteng include proficiency in programming languages such as Java, Python, or C++, knowledge of cloud platforms like AWS or Azure, and experience with agile development methodologies. Additionally, understanding of data analysis and interpretation, cybersecurity principles, and IT project management are often essential. Familiarity with popular software applications, such as Microsoft Office 365 or Google Workspace, is also beneficial.

The financ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and government departments are among the common industries that employ IT and computing professionals in Gauteng. These sectors require a range of skills and expertise, from data analysis to network administration, making them attractive options for career development.
